Hi all,
I am amicably divorcing my ex as we have been separated for over two years. I used wikivorce who have been slooooow (lost my paperwork at one point!!. Anyway like an idiot I missed out my exes middle name, so it got rejected and an amended petition has now been filed and approved. My question is what happens now? Someone mentioned that it now goes back to the beginning of the process as if you were starting a divorce from scratch all over again. Does anyone know if this is true, or what the key stages are from now?
Like an idiot I have booked a wedding with my partner next June and am starting to panic (divorce has been going on for almost 9 months - can't believe it has taken this long when my ex and I are still such good friends!)
Thanks all

I don't know whether it goes back to the start, but depending on when you have booked in June you could be cutting it fine as the DA not be issued until 6 weeks and 1 day after DN is issued.
So if DN was issued tomorrow the first day for your DA would be the 9th June.
Frankly I would prepare to need to rearrange your wedding.
